PROSPECTS AND OPPORTUNITIES
Lack of preventive care stifles strong volume sales over the forecast period
Despite the anticipated gradual growth of the landscape, retail sales volume is not set to experience strong growth over the forecast period. There is an insufficient emphasis on preventive dermatological care practices among consumers.
The rising birth rate leads to positive growth for paediatric dermatological products
Increased birth rates correlate with an expanding landscape for paediatric dermatological products. Infants and children are particularly susceptible to dermatological conditions such as diaper rash, eczema, and cradle cap, thereby driving the demand for specialised dermatological solutions tailored for paediatric care.
Narrow portfolio of local producers across the forecast period
In contrast to the widespread popularity observed for products such as analgesics and cough and cold remedies, the adoption and production of dermatological treatments by local manufacturers in Uzbekistan exhibit a relatively slow pace. Local producers, such as Radiks NPP and Dentafill Plyus, predominantly concentrate on essential products or straightforward, well-established generics.
